The Diocese of Gloucester Academies Trust is delighted to advertise for the post of Headteacher at Watermoor CofE Primary School. This is a permanent, full-time position from1 January 2027. This role provides an exciting opportunity for a motivated and experienced leader to lead a team of passionate teaching and support staff to ensure high quality teaching and learning. We are seeking an individual who can inspire and develop others, who has a clear understanding of excellent teaching and learning, and who leads with passion, inclusivity and integrity. You will be someone who builds trust and confidence within your community, enabling both children and adults to flourish. We would also value a willingness to contribute to and share strong practice across our family of schools. A strong commitment to excellence in school leadership, alongside an understanding of and alignment with the values ofschoolandTrustwith a Church of England foundation, is essential. As a Headteacher within our Trust, you will have the opportunity to lead a school with its own distinct identity and context, while benefiting from the support, expertise and constructive challenge of a highly skilled central team. You will also be part of a collegiate group of Headteachers who are collaborative, innovative and solution-focused in their approach to leadership. We are proud to offer a wide range of professional development opportunities and will actively support your leadership journey and career progression. Equally important to us is the pastoral care of our Headteachers. We recognise the depth of care they show to others, and we are committed to ensuring they feel supported, valued and able to prioritise their own wellbeing. We are looking for someone who: *can clearly articulate a compelling vision of educational excellence *is passionately committed to the ethos of the school *inspires, leads and motivates all staff and pupils to give of their best *is committed to the Trust’s vision of inclusive education *can build excellent relationships with all stakeholders *is committed to collaboration with neighbouring schools and wider Trust schools.
